Description

Socket Mobile CX4602-3864 Bluetooth 1D/2D Barcode Scanner

The Socket Mobile CX4602-3864 is a Bluetooth-enabled handheld barcode scanner purpose-built for mobile-first retail, warehouse, and logistics operations. The integrated 1D/2D scan engine captures UPC and standard barcode formats reliably across varied lighting and angle conditions. Bluetooth Low Energy connectivity eliminates USB tethering entirely, allowing workers to scan from tablets, smartphones, or fixed terminals without cable management overhead — a critical operational advantage in high-velocity pick-and-pack or point-of-sale environments.

Key Features

  • 1D/2D Scan Engine: Captures UPC, Code 128, QR, and standard barcode formats. Multi-format support future-proofs deployments as labeling standards evolve.
  • Bluetooth Low Energy (BLE): Pairs with Android, iOS, and Windows devices without requiring proprietary drivers or USB infrastructure. Power-efficient pairing keeps runtime measured in days, not hours.
  • Handheld Form Factor: Ergonomic grip designed for all-shift scanning in retail checkout, warehouse receiving, or field inventory audits. Reduces hand fatigue in high-volume environments.
  • Multi-Platform Support: Works natively with Android, iOS, and Windows mobile platforms. Integrates with standard mobile inventory apps, POS systems, and warehouse management software (WMS) via standard barcode keyboard emulation.
  • Device Agnostic: Pairs with smartphones, tablets, enterprise mobile computers, and fixed terminals simultaneously — allows a single scanner to roam across departments or be docked at a workstation.
  • No Proprietary Infrastructure: BLE operates on globally open 2.4 GHz ISM band. No specialized access points, no vendor lock-in on networking hardware.
  • Manufacturer Warranty: 1-year coverage on hardware defects and scan engine performance.

The CX4602-3864 is designed for environments where workers move between fixed stations and handheld mobile devices. Retail associates scanning SKUs at point-of-sale, warehouse staff conducting cycle counts on tablets, or field technicians logging asset barcodes — all benefit from BLE pairing that requires zero IT provisioning. The absence of cables and USB hubs simplifies deployment and reduces the per-device hardware footprint.

Barcode keyboard emulation means the scanner inputs data directly into any field on any platform — no custom middleware required. This is the differentiator for small-to-midmarket retailers and logistics operators who run multiple POS vendors, WMS platforms, or legacy spreadsheet-based workflows. The scanner bridges them all with transparent data injection.

Battery life and re-pairing behavior are critical in mobile deployments. Socket Mobile CX4602-3864 uses standard BLE low-power profiles; expect multi-day runtime on a single charge in intermittent-scan usage (typical retail or warehouse environment). Re-pairing after power loss is automatic — no IT intervention required. For operations running 24/7 shifts, staging multiple charged units and hot-swapping them is faster and cheaper than managing wired scanners and dock stations.

Integration considerations: Confirm BLE stack support on target devices before deployment. Older Windows PCs or fixed terminals may require a low-cost BLE USB dongle. Test keyboard emulation mode with your specific POS or WMS vendor — 99% support standard HID input, but custom barcode formats (like GS1-128 with application identifiers) may require your software to parse and process the injected data. Socket Mobile provides open APIs and SDKs for teams building custom mobile workflows; standard barcode-as-text input works everywhere else.

We've deployed the CX4602-3864 across retail chains, 3PL warehouses, and field service operations where tablet-first workflows are the standard. The real operational advantage isn't the barcode reading — any modern scanner does that reliably. It's the elimination of wired infrastructure. On a retail floor with 12 checkout lanes, you no longer need 12 USB cables, 12 mounting brackets, or IT time managing cable breaks. A single CX4602 pairs to an iPad at register A, gets picked up and re-paired to a tablet at the customer service desk 30 seconds later, then moves to inventory receiving. That flexibility cuts hardware costs and training overhead measurably. We've also seen BLE pairing prove valuable in warehouses where Android devices are mounted on order-picking carts — the scanner maintains connection range over typical pick-line distances (30–50 meters) without dropped scans or re-pairing hiccups. The one caveat: if your operation is 100% legacy fixed PCs running Windows 7 or older Windows terminals without BLE chipsets, you'll need a USB dongle or a different scanner family. But for mobile-first operations — which is 80% of new deployments we see — the CX4602-3864 is the simpler, lower-TCO choice versus wired alternatives.

Technical Highlights:

  • 1D/2D Scan Engine: Decodes UPC, Code 128, QR, DataMatrix, and 20+ symbologies. Field-proven across retail, healthcare (patient ID labels), and logistics (shipping labels). No software-side barcode decoding needed — hardware engine returns clean alphanumeric data.
  • Bluetooth Low Energy (BLE): Pairs with iOS 5+, Android 4.3+, Windows 10+ natively. No proprietary drivers. Power consumption is 10–15 mW in scan mode, enabling 3–5 day battery life in typical retail/warehouse intermittent-use patterns. Automatic re-pairing after sleep/wake cycles avoids operational friction.
  • Keyboard Emulation Mode: Scanner injects barcode data as if a keyboard typed it — works in any field on any platform without custom integration. If your POS system accepts text input, the CX4602-3864 works out of the box.
  • SDK & API Support: Socket Mobile provides open iOS/Android SDKs for teams building custom inventory or field-service apps. Standard keyboard emulation mode requires zero SDK dependency — reduces development risk and time-to-deployment for integrators with tight schedules.
  • Ruggedness for Mobile: IP54 rated enclosure — survives drops, dust, and incidental splashes. Designed for handheld use in retail floor and warehouse environments, not laboratory benches.

Deployment Considerations:

  • BLE chipset requirement: Confirm target devices (tablets, phones, terminals) have integrated BLE or budget for a low-cost USB BLE dongle (~$20–40) if deploying on legacy fixed workstations. Most modern mobile devices ship with BLE built-in.
  • Pairing overhead: Initial BLE pairing takes 30–60 seconds per device. In high-churn environments (temporary devices, contractor tablets), consider a shared pool of pre-paired units or a pairing workflow documented in staff training. Avoid ad-hoc re-pairing mid-shift.
  • Range and interference: BLE operates at 2.4 GHz alongside Wi-Fi and cellular. In dense retail or warehouse environments with multiple Wi-Fi APs, range may compress to 20–30 meters. Plan placement of base devices (POS tablets, order-picking carts) accordingly. Intervening metal shelving can reduce range by 30–40%.
  • Barcode format validation: Custom barcode formats (e.g., GS1-128 with embedded application identifiers) may require parsing logic in your POS/WMS software. Standard UPC, Code 128, and QR work immediately. Confirm format support with your software vendor before purchase.
  • Battery management: In continuous all-shift use, stage 2–3 charged units per workstation. Charging time is 2–3 hours via USB-C. Build a simple rotation schedule to avoid downtime mid-shift.
